I think I figured out the synopsis for the PIC code:
- wake
- read RB0 into temp reg (int vector)
- few compares to get the RS232 pattern
- if compares don't match SLEEP (including "FF")
- RS232: put out RS232 bits
- wait repeat time
- compare RB0 to temp reg
- if same goto RS232 else SLEEP
- end

Note that I still have to figure out the repeat time. In any case it is less
than 250ms but more than 208us (figures!). Also a repeat time delay is needed.
Would 500ms be OK? Same as typematic delay on keyboard...
